The District Surveyors appointed by the Metropolitan Board
of Works are as under:—
In-Wards.—Mr. T. H. Watson. Office: 9, Conduit-street.
Office hours, 11 to 3.
Out-Wards.—Mr. Geo. Legg. Office: 19, Burton-street,
Eaton-square.
Office hours, 10 to 4.
The following are fixed points in this Parish, where
Police Constables are permanently stationed from 9 a.m.
to 1 a.m., viz:—
C Division.
Top corner of St. Jamcs's-street, Piccadilly.
Corner of Hamilton-place and Piccadilly.
Hyde Park-corner by Apsloy House.
Oxford-street circus, corner of Swallow-passage, south
side of Oxford-street, west of Regent-street.
Corner of Park-lane and Oxford street.
Corner of Davies-street and Oxford-street.
Corner of Mount-street and South Audley-street.
Corner of Charles-street and John-street, May Fair.
Corner of New Bond-street and Conduit-street.
Corner of Berkeley-street and Piccadilly.
B Division.
Corner of Belgrave-square, Chesham-place.
Albert-gate, Knightsbridgo.
Victoria Railway Station, Buckingham Palace-road.
Victoria railway Station, Junction of Victoria-street
and Vauxhall Bridge-road.
Eaton-square, near St. Peter's Church.
